Compare prices across different online pharmacies. Websites like GoodRx often list discounted prices.
Utilize manufacturer coupons or rebates. Check the Alli website and pharmacy websites for current offers.
Explore patient assistance programs. Many pharmaceutical companies offer programs to help patients afford their medications; check with the manufacturer.
Consider purchasing a larger quantity. Buying a larger pack might offer a lower price per pill, despite the higher upfront cost.
Look for generic alternatives. While Alli is a brand-name drug, investigate whether a comparable generic exists that achieves similar weight loss results at a reduced cost.
Negotiate price with your local pharmacy. Some pharmacies are willing to negotiate prices, especially for regular customers purchasing large quantities.
Take advantage of loyalty programs. Many pharmacies offer discounts for their loyalty members, often including prescription medications.
Check your insurance coverage. Your health insurance plan might cover a portion of the cost of Alli, reducing your out-of-pocket expenses.
Use a prescription discount card. Numerous discount cards are available online or from various organizations to lower prescription costs. Carefully compare the savings offered by different cards.
Time your refills strategically. Purchasing refills during sales periods or special promotions can save you money. Keep track of when Alli is discounted.
